Struct holochain::prelude::dependencies::kitsune_p2p_types::dependencies::lair_keystore_api::dependencies::hc_seed_bundle::dependencies::sodoken::buffer::BufWriteMemLocked
source · pub struct BufWriteMemLocked(_);
Expand description
This writable buffer type is mem_locked. Use this for passwords / private keys, etc, but NOT everything, locked memory is a finite resource.
